I'm checking my app for Memory Leaks/Usage and came across something
weird that I've only seen so far in Android 1.6 and 2.1. After
clicking around in the app a bit and I run "adb shell dumpsys meminfo"
for my application, I see the following:

DUMP OF SERVICE meminfo:
Applications Memory Usage (kB):
Uptime: 34639912 Realtime: 153524709

** MEMINFO in pid 5778 [com.app.myapp] **
                        native    dalvik     other   total
            size:    14336     4679      N/A    19015
       allocated:  13971     4139      N/A    18110
            free:        280       540      N/A       820
           (Pss):     2986     4181    13491    20658
  (shared dirty):    972     3948      620       5540
    (priv dirty):     2876     3224    10976    17076

 Objects
                 Views:      545          ViewRoots:        4
       AppContexts:       32             Activities:       31
                Assets:        2    AssetManagers:        2
       Local Binders:       43     Proxy Binders:       79
  Death Recipients:        2
OpenSSL Sockets:        1

 SQL
                heap:       91               dbFiles:        0
       numPagers:        4   inactivePageKB:        0
    activePageKB:        0

 Asset Allocations
    zip:/data/app/com.app.myapp.apk:/resources.arsc: 119K

The memory dump was after clicking around in the app, going from
Activity to Activity and that is all.  This isn't reproduce-able in
2.2+ and it seems that I'm either missing something simple, or there's
something about pre 2.2 versions of Android that I'm just not aware
of.  What could be the cause of this?

The app will eventually crash with an OutOfMemoryError once the
objects pile up.  Thanks!
